Stress urinary incontinence happens with unexpected stress on the bladder and urethra (television that brings pee from the bladder out of the body). This stress creates the sphincter muscle mass inside the urethra to briefly open up, permitting urine ahead out. Any type of activity-- bending over, jumping, coughing or sneezing, for example-- may squeeze the bladder. It frequently impacts the urinary system in individuals designated woman at birth (AFAB). As numerous as 1 in 3 people that were AFAB will experience stress and anxiety urinary system incontinence at some time.
